Subject outline
The subject provides students with an opportunity to conduct research on a topic of their interest. Students will work with an assigned supervisor to decide on a topic. The student will then be guided by the supervisor to complete a thorough review of the literature on the topic. During the course of the review, the student will be provided with opportunities to present their progress to a panel which includes their supervisor. It is expected that on successful completion of the subject. The student will have a piece of written work in a specified area that could potentially be published in a peer review journal such as Journal of Accounting Literature. Such a written piece of work can form the background for a thesis for the Bachelor of Accounting Honours.
